diff --git a/src/views/IdtyItem.vue b/src/views/IdtyItem.vue
index ddc94f397ffcd464722470baac5a543f8dd6520d..fcc75f5b83cea653c3b5a98a2382b38890b74e83 100644
--- a/src/views/IdtyItem.vue
+++ b/src/views/IdtyItem.vue
@@ -110,7 +110,11 @@ const displayInfos = computed(
     idty.value?.status == IdentityStatusEnum.Unconfirmed ||
     idty.value?.status == IdentityStatusEnum.Unvalidated
 )
-const waitingCerts = computed(() => idty.value?.certReceived && receivedCertCount.value < 5)
+const waitingCerts = computed(
+  () =>
+    idty.value?.certReceived &&
+    receivedCertCount.value < api.consts.wot.minCertForMembership.toNumber()
+)
 const certToIsActive = computed(
   () =>
     loginIdtyName.value != null &&